How Marketing Executive Recruiters Aid Business Hiring

If you haven't heard of the term “marketing executive recruiter” you are probably very familiar with the term “head hunter. ” A marketing executive recruiter is simply someone hired to find marketing professionals at the executive level.

They make it their business to connect the best marketing professionals with companies in need of their expertise. Some may wonder what this might have to do with their particular company. Do you have such questions?

You might also be assuming you can handle your own hiring. While you may have the qualifications to do so, you might not have the time to handle all the various components of the process.

You would need to call candidates in for an interview, eliminate the ones that are not a proper fit for your company, and then actually decide on the person you wish to hire. All of these activities will compete with all the other various aspects of running the office. Never lose sight of the fact you always have your own job to do.

You would probably not want to waste much time (upwards of several hours) running job ads, reviewing resumes, and interviewing various different candidates. This process becomes further time consuming due to the number of people that lack the qualifications for executive level positions that wish to apply anyway. Such applicants need to be sorted out and eliminated if you wish to find the proper professionals that are worth the time to interview. Even when you have the potential to delegate such time-consuming tasks to an assistant or a member of your staff, your office would be wasting a great deal of valuable time searching for qualified marketing professionals. Why not let someone else do all of it for you? So, what is it exactly that you are doing when you hire a marketing executive recruiter? Namely, you will be delegating the candidate search duties to an individual with proper expertise in finding marketing pros. Yes, it can be overwhelmingly difficult to scour through the unqualified applicants at times. A skilled head hunter will already possess the proper contacts with top professionals in the industry.

If they cannot find the right person among their contacts, they do understand the steps of how to bring them in. When you hire a skilled marketing executive recruiter, you will gain more qualified applicants than you would have found on your own.

You will discover them arriving in a much shorter period of time as well.

You will end up with job candidates that you probably would not have otherwise come across if you were advertising through the traditional channel. Consider this scenario for a second: you take out an advertisement in the local paper to promote your executive marketing position. To your chagrin, you discover not many people are actually reading the papers these days. Certainly, this will not aid your ability to hire the right candidates to fill executive level positions in marketing.

It is possible to list a job on an online job board but such resources are cluttered and sometimes disorganized. This makes it easy to get frustrated and quit. This can occur before they come across all available opportunities.

The best bet here is to procure the services of a recruiter that has connections in the industry. Such a pro will be able to find the proper candidate for your needs. This leads you to maintaining a wider selection of pros to select from.

You will not have to waste a lot of time posting tons of ads, weeding out the less qualified, and conducting interviews with the wrong candidates.
